Alright, I'm looking to get a 5 axis, 3+2, post for X3. I started with my dealer, but after some research. I found ICAM and PostHASTE. I have submitted information to all three to see what they comeback with. All sound very competent.

 

If you all would be so kind. What are the pros and cons on running a MC post verses a third party post like PostHASTE? Our dealer only writes up t 4 axis, so it will be created by a by someone outside their company. Maybe some of you running PostHASTE can expand on your experience.

PostHast runs out side you post NCI and then run this thru posthast to create the code.

 

Paul has been doing this for along time and for many Cadcam systems.

 

Your dealer will get it done but sounds like they will source it to one of the other dealers for help.But you will get a internal working post for most likely less money.

 

the New option for Icam is nice as it will be built to support your machine and have the option for Michine Simulation and tool checking.
